Now how can I make my food fun you ask? Well, go on a picnic! My challenge to you is to go on a picnic! You can do it today or plan one for this weekend! Make healthy options!
It does not have to be fussy. A picnic is totally what yoiu want it to be:
You can get some healthy fast food and sit on a bench or a blanket and eat with a friend
Make your own sandwiches or pasta salad some fruit and go to a park picnic table
Just get some crackers cheese and grapes and eat in the sun
Have lemonade or ice tea in the backyard!
Picnics are fun I have learned because so free to be outdoors and the food can be as simple or complicated as you like just make it fun!
The blanket, bench or picnic table is your choosing. Maybe bring a frisbee and get some activity too!
PS if it rains on your parade get a blanket put in living room and still have picnic...you will love it.
